EP. 22: Escaping the Cult: Nancy's Fight for Freedom from WWASPS
In Episode 22 of the Pinky J Podcast, we dive into the harrowing story of Nancy, a survivor of the notorious WWASPS (World Wide Association of Specialty Programs and Schools). Founded in 1998 by Robert Lichfield, WWASPS claimed to provide education and treatment for troubled teens but was plagued by allegations of severe abuse and manipulation.Nancy recounts her time at Red River Academy in Louisiana, where she faced abusive punishments and isolation at just 13 years old.
